Just to be sure, try the above command for different widgets from 0x0a to 0x12.
All these correspond to different I/O pin. (The headphone should be 0x0a,
according to the BIOS information, though.)
I'm not entirely sure whether it's a mismatch of box-cable in your case. But,
I've heard similar problems from other guys. They use a box designed for older
mobos with AC97 codec chip, which is slightly incompatible with the recent one
with HD-audio codec.
